Police Capture Suspect After Car Chase On I-95

BRISTOL TOWNSHIP, Pa. (CBS) - A suspect was taken into police custody after leading police on a chase that began in Delaware County and ended in Bucks County.

Police say Paul McCurry, 19, was driving a stolen 2008 black Pontiac coupe on I-95 in Tinicum Township, Delaware County when police tried to stop him. Authorities say he took off on 95 North, crossing into Philadelphia.

The chase began in Ridley Township, Delaware County at about 6:30 a.m. and ended in Bristol Township, Bucks County around 8:30 a.m.

"At mile marker 27, which is a couple miles past Girard [Avenue], the pursuant vehicle struck another vehicle," said Pennsylvania State Police Trooper Danea Durham. "We don't have an exact speed he was going, but I'm sure it was at a higher rate of speed."

The chase ended on northbound I-95 near Route 413 in Bucks County with the suspect's stolen car spinning out of control and crashing against a guardrail.

Police say McCurry ran down an embankment toward a wooded area near Route 413. Bensalem police used a K-9 team to search an industrial area near Newportville Road. They eventually caught up with McCurry in a fenced-in area, and he was taken into custody around 8:30 a.m.

There are no reports of any injuries.
